Malta’s new VAT exemption scheme

VAT was first introduced in Malta in 1995 and has undergone various changes since then. Most of these changes were made when Malta joined the European Union. The Maltese government'a main goal was to reduce the tax charges in order to attract more investors into the country.

Redomiciliation of companies in Malta

There are a plethora of benefits that come with setting up a company in Malta. Apart from the attractive tax rates, the Maltese jurisdiction offers numerous incentives for investors who want to do business in Malta. As a result, a lot of companies are redomiciling to Malta in order to benefit from the Island’s business pro-environment. Re-domiciliation is when a company transfers its registration from one jurisdiction (country) to another.
